Many years ago in a period commonly know as Next Friday Afternoon,
there lived a King who was very Gloomy on Tuesday mornings because he
was so Sad thinking about how Unhappy he had been on Monday and how
completely Mournful he would be on Wednesday....
-- Walt Kelly


Don't take life so serious, son, it ain't nohow permanent.
-- Walt Kelly


Food for thought is no substitute for the real thing.
-- Walt Kelly, "Potluck Pogo"


If you wants to get elected president, you'se got to think up some
memoraboble homily so's school kids can be pestered into memorizin'
it, even if they don't know what it means.
-- Walt Kelly, "The Pogo Party"


Don't take life so serious, son, it ain't nohow permanent.

-- Walt Kelly


He: Let's end it all, bequeathin' our brains to science.
She: What?!? Science got enough trouble with their OWN brains.
-- Walt Kelly


Ladybug, ladybug,
Look to your stern!
Your house is on fire,
Your children will burn!
So jump ye and sing, for
The very first time
The four lines above
Have been put into rhyme.
-- Walt Kelly


There's no easy quick way out, we're gonna have to live through our
whole lives, win, lose, or draw.

-- Walt Kelly


Twenty Percent of Zero is Better than Nothing.
-- Walt Kelly


We are confronted with insurmountable opportunities.

-- Walt Kelly, "Pogo"


There's no easy quick way out, we're gonna have to live through our
whole lives, win, lose, or draw.
-- Walt Kelly


A possum must be himself, and being himself he is honest.
-- Walt Kelly


Thank goodness modern convenience is a thing of the remote future.
-- Pogo, by Walt Kelly


We have met the enemy, and he is us.
-- Walt Kelly


Twenty Percent of Zero is Better than Nothing.

-- Walt Kelly
